Syncope and harsh systolic murmur

Which diagnosis best explains this presentation?

A 76-year-old man presents with exertional syncope and chest discomfort. On examination there is a harsh crescendo-decrescendo systolic murmur loudest at the right upper sternal border radiating to the carotids.
